Subject: Blueprints for the Corvers Lane permit — out today

Hi dispatch,

The blueprint tubes for the Corvers Lane building permit need to reach the Selwich planning office before 4pm, or we miss this month's review slot. Two tubes, both capped and taped, sitting in the plan rack by the roller door. Marrow Couriers are booked for the 1pm slot. When the rider shows up, do the usual check first.

handover note for tadug-yaguf: the aldath pelwyn courier leaves the casox norwyn briix silok zorok kasdor aldion quenox ledger at gate 2653 under passcode 959015

Support staff verifying a customer-reported stale response should first confirm the feed signature rather than assuming a propagation delay: an invalid signature means the feed was rejected by design, not lost. Verification requires the current release signing identity, which is rotated quarterly and announced in the support channel. The active key appears below.

signing key of kagaf-fahap = bky3_CfS

## Deployment

The Bramblewick admin dashboard ships dark-mode support as a build-time feature flag plus a runtime theme service. Before deploying, compile the theme bundle, confirm both palettes pass the contrast checker, and clear the CDN cache so stale stylesheets don't mix themes. The theme service reads its settings once at startup. Deploy with the configuration values listed directly below.

config for tagep-yajef:
ulawyn:
  log_level: error
  metrics_host: metrics.ulawyn.lumiclabs.internal
  pin: 0564
  pool_size: 32